Planned Giving: Building an Effective Program

This comprehensive course is designed to equip participants with the knowledge and tools needed to develop and grow a successful planned giving program. Key topics include:


  • Advanced and integrated marketing strategies
  • Planned gift administration
  • Donor recognition
  • Developing a comprehensive planned gift plan
  • Identifying potential donors
  • Cultivating relationships
  • Navigating legal and ethical considerations

Course Details

  • The course is designed for one fundraiser and one team member from an organization to attend together.
  • The team member should be the CEO, Executive Director, finance team member, board member, or other member of the leadership team.
  • Certificates: Planned Giving Management
  • Course Dates and Locations:
    • Indianapolis (NCAA): April 09, 2026 - April 10, 2026, $1,295.00
    • Virtual (Live): April 15, 2026 - May 06, 2026, $1,295.00
    • Indianapolis (NCAA): June 08, 2026 - June 09, 2026, $1,295.00

Schedule

  • In-person classes are two days in length, from 8:30 a.m.-5 p.m.
  • Virtual classes are held over four sessions, from 2 p.m.-5 p.m. Eastern, using the Zoom platform.
